Iran Clears Vessels
  • Iran and Western intermediaries cleared eleven vessels through the Strait of Hormuz, ending a backlog.
  • The tankers and bulk carriers bound for Indian ports Nhava Sheva and Mundra had been idling.
  • The clearance reduced the immediate backlog by nearly fifteen percent within a forty-eight hour window.
  • Maritime analysts say the ad-hoc Memorandum of Understanding guarantees Iran’s oil sales and asset liquidity while promising non-interference for vetted vessels.
